Q-omics provides the consensus-scored RNU6-1323P profile across patient tissues and cancer cell-line models. RNU6-1323P expression is associated with patient survival in 9 of 34 cancer types, with the highest sampling consensus in SKCM. Additionally, RNU6-1323P RNA expression shows 4,304 significant pathway-activity associations, with the highest sampling consensus in STAD. Together, these results highlight SKCM, and STAD as cancer lineages where RNU6-1323P shows reproducible signals across survival, tumor–normal expression, and patient cross-omics analyses.

Every result is evaluated using two consensus scores. Sampling consensus measures how consistently a finding is reproduced within a cancer lineage across different conditions. Lineage consensus measures how broadly the result is shared across cancer types, distinguishing pan-cancer signals from lineage-specific patterns.

This table ranks reproducible RNU6-1323P RNA expression–survival associations across cancer types. High RNU6-1323P expression shows unfavorable associations in SKCM, HNSC, LUSC, BRCA, TGCT and LUAD. The SKCM Kaplan–Meier curve shows clear separation, with the high-expression group declining faster, consistent with the unfavorable association (log-rank p < 0.001). Together, the overview and detailed table identify SKCM as the clearest survival context for RNU6-1323P RNA expression.
